Return on Investment
A financial metric that calculates the profitability of an investment by dividing the net profit by the initial cost.
Support Department Allocations
The process of distributing overhead costs from support departments to producing departments based on predetermined criteria.
Operating Income
is the profit realized from a business's operations after deducting operating expenses such as wages and depreciation, but before interest and taxes.
Residual Income
Residual income is the amount of net income generated beyond the minimum return expected by an entity or on an investment, often used as a measure of corporate and individual performance.
